CUSTOMER SERVICE

+1 (720) 805-1926

Monday to Friday

10am - 5.30pm (New York time)

PRODUCTS & ORDERS

+1 (720) 805-1926

Monday to Friday

10am - 5.30pm (New York time)

STORE LOCATOR

521 Fifth Avenue, Pelham, NY 10783

Hi, We will be glad to assist you in any question

And encourage you to share your ideas and improvements with us.

You can also use the form below.

 

Have a question about a product, our company, or just want to chat? Email us!